599CN.COM - 【源码之家】老牌网站源码下载站,提供完整商业网站源码下载!

react vue混合

源码网2023-07-16 22:18:14208reactReact Vue开发

深入探究React和Vue混合开发的优势和技术要点

1. React和Vue的简介

React和Vue是两个热门的JavaScript前端框架,它们各自具有独特的特点和功能。React是由Facebook开发的,注重构建可复用的UI组件,具有强大的虚拟DOM、单向数据流等特性。Vue则由尤雨溪开发,并秉承了"渐进式"的理念,可以逐步应用于项目中,同时提供了轻量级的解决方案。

2.混合开发的背景和意义

众所周知,每个框架都有自己的优势和劣势,而纯粹使用React或Vue进行开发可能会限制在某些方面的发展。混合开发的意义在于可以取长补短,充分利用两个框架的优点,以提升开发效率和用户体验。

3.如何实现React和Vue的混合开发

混合开发可以通过将React和Vue结合在同一个项目中,实现对两个框架的共同利用。具体而言,可以利用Vue的MVVM模式,将React组件作为Vue的子组件进行嵌套使用。通过这种方式,React和Vue可以在相同的项目中共同协作,以实现更加灵活、高效的开发。

4. 混合开发的优势和应用场景

混合开发的优势在于可以充分发挥React和Vue各自的特点。由于React具有强大的生态系统和庞大的社区支持,对于大型、复杂的应用程序开发更具优势。Vue则更适合快速构建简单、中小型的项目。混合开发能够根据项目需求灵活使用React和Vue,以实现最佳的开发效果。

5. 混合开发的技术要点和最佳实践

在进行混合开发时,需要注意以下技术要点和最佳实践:

1. 组件通信:React和Vue组件之间的通信可以通过Props、事件、vuex等方式实现,确保数据的流通和一致性。

2. 路由管理:在混合开发中,可以使用Vue Router来管理整个应用程序的路由,同时利用React Router实现React组件的路由控制。

3. 状态管理:对于复杂的应用,可以使用Redux或Mobx来管理全局状态,确保React和Vue组件的状态同步。

4. 样式管理:在混合开发中,可以使用CSS Modules或CSS-in-JS来管理样式,以避免样式冲突和混乱。

5. 构建工具:使用Webpack或Parcel等构建工具,将React和Vue打包成可部署的静态文件。

通过遵循上述技术要点和最佳实践,开发人员可以在React和Vue混合开发中取得更好的结果。尽管混合开发涉及一定的学习和调整成本,但它带来的灵活性和效率提升是值得的。

总之,React Vue混合开发是一种结合两大前端框架的最佳实践,可以让开发人员充分利用React和Vue的优势。通过混合开发,可以灵活地利用两个框架的功能,并使其共同协作,以实现更高效、更优质的前端开发。

转载声明:本站发布文章及版权归原作者所有,转载本站文章请注明文章来源!

本文链接:https://599cn.com/post/18024.html